01) Schmidt Hammer Test Introduction Schmidt hammer test is mostly used to determine the compressive strength of any erected concrete structure. And that is also called as a Swiss hammer or a rebound hammer. Schmidt hammer is a device to measure compressive strength of concrete or rock, mainly using surface hardness and penetration resistance. This instrument portable and easy to handle in any places.
